1. What is a Natural Rodent Repellent?

Natural rodent repellents are a breath of fresh air in the world of pest control. Unlike traditional methods that often involve harsh chemicals, these alternatives are derived from environmentally friendly sources. These repellents aim to deter mice without compromising the safety of your home environment.

2. Types of Natural Rodent Repellents

2.1 Plant-Derived Repellents

Peppermint Oil Magic: One popular choice among natural rodent repellents is peppermint oil. Its potent scent overwhelms the sensitive noses of mice, making your home an undesirable space for them.

Citronella Sensation: Citronella, known for its mosquito-repelling properties, can also be effective against mice. The citrusy aroma disrupts their olfactory senses, encouraging them to seek refuge elsewhere.

Eucalyptus Elegance: The strong, camphoraceous scent of eucalyptus is another deterrent for mice. Incorporating eucalyptus-based products can create an unwelcome environment for these unwanted houseguests.

2.2 Natural Predators

Feline Friends: While not a direct repellent, the presence of cats can act as a natural deterrent. Mice are instinctively wary of predators, and the mere scent of a cat can keep them at bay.

Feathered Guardians: Birds of prey, such as owls or hawks, contribute to biological pest control. Encouraging the presence of these natural predators in your area can help regulate the rodent population.

2.3 Homemade Repellents

Spices and Everything Nice: Crafting your own repellent can be both fun and effective. Combine pungent spices like cayenne pepper or garlic with water to create a homemade spray. The strong flavors act as a natural deterrent.

3. How Do Natural Rodent Repellents Work?

Understanding the science behind these repellents is key to maximizing their effectiveness. Mice have highly sensitive olfactory systems, and the powerful scents from natural repellents disrupt their communication and navigation, steering them away from treated areas.

Consistency is key when using natural repellents. Regular applications and strategic placement in potential entry points or nesting areas can enhance their efficacy.

4. Advantages and Disadvantages of Natural Rodent Repellents

4.1 Advantages

Eco-Friendly Elegance: One of the most significant advantages is the eco-friendly nature of these repellents. You can create a pest-free environment without harming the planet.

Chemical-Free Living: Say goodbye to harsh chemicals. Natural rodent repellents provide a safer alternative for households with children and pets.

Aromatherapy Bonus: Many natural repellents come with pleasant scents, turning pest control into a sensory delight for your home.

4.2 Disadvantages

Effectiveness Variables: The effectiveness of natural repellents can vary based on factors like the severity of the infestation and environmental conditions.

Regular Applications Required: Unlike some traditional methods with long-lasting effects, natural repellents may require more frequent application to maintain their efficacy.

Not a One-Size-Fits-All Solution: While effective in many cases, natural repellents might not be the ultimate solution for extreme infestations.
